AI Summary

  • Modifies county payment obligations for care at Anoka-Metro Regional Treatment Center: zero percent for first 30 days, 20 percent for days 31 and over if clinically appropriate, and 100 percent on discharge days unless discharge plan refers to community competency restoration program.

  • Updates community behavioral health hospital payment requirements to 100 percent for discharge days only (if discharge plan does not recommend referral to competency restoration program and facility meets notice requirements).

  • Requires facilities to send notice and preliminary discharge plan to county and commissioner 10 days before client discharge; commissioner and facility must partner with county to find appropriate placement, and county cannot be charged if discharge is delayed by facility.

  • Directs commissioner to maintain and share with counties a comprehensive, continuously updated list of providers and facilities available for timely and appropriate client placement upon discharge.

  • Adds counties' disputes over cost of care under section 246.54 as grounds for state agency hearings under section 256.045.
